E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
moniter
synchronized关键字以及底层实现
锁升级对象的内存结构ⅰ.对象头1.①运行时元数据(MarkWord)(占64位)a.哈希值(HashCode)b.GC分代年龄c.锁状态标记2.②类型指针:(KlassPoint)(占32位)ⅱ.实例数据ⅲ.对齐填充
Moniter
米开浪
·
2024-02-13 08:54
多线程
java
Openresty 配置访问静态文件,拆分路径
server{listen8080;location/{#default_typetext/html;#content_by_lua'#ngx.say("hello,world")#';root/work/
moniter
-web
Devops海洋的渔夫
·
2023-11-06 08:41
c# Monitor.wait() 经典实例
c#Monitor.wait()和sleep的区别a、
moniter
继承的积累为object,sleep继承thread类b、
moniter
.wait(),会阻塞线程,阻塞的同时但会释放锁,再次获得锁的时候
zls365365
·
2023-10-10 07:17
队列
多线程
java
thread
并发编程
深入理解java中的AQS和synchronized
最后面试官问到比较深,问我
moniter
里面啥内容,我就记得waitsets,entrylist,owner,count这几个synchronized是Java中的关键
xxx_520s
·
2023-07-20 21:02
java
锁
AQS
(转载)深入理解多线程(四)——
Moniter
的实现原理
原文链接:深入理解多线程(四)——
Moniter
的实现原理-HollisChuang'sBlog在深入理解多线程(一)——Synchronized的实现原理中介绍过关于Synchronize的实现原理,
Walter_Hu
·
2023-04-06 08:40
深入理解多线程(四)——
Moniter
的实现原理
原文转载:http://www.hollischuang.com/archives/2030在深入理解多线程(一)——Synchronized的实现原理中介绍过关于Synchronize的实现原理,无论是同步方法还是同步代码块,无论是ACC_SYNCHRONIZED还是monitorenter、monitorexit都是基于Monitor实现的,那么这篇来介绍下什么是Monitor。操作系统中的管
MiaLing007
·
2023-03-23 08:16
zabbix自动发现指定目录次级目录大小LLD脚本
1脚本内容[root@yswscript]#catdir_size.
moniter
.sh#!
醉眼看人间_个个都温柔
·
2022-02-15 02:11
C# semaphore的使用线程锁
你也可以用lock(),
moniter
(),这两个线程同步使用简单些,代
深圳视觉软件JJ
·
2021-05-08 14:17
C#
aircrack_ng + crunch暴力破解wlan密码
2.airmon-ng查看支持监控(
moniter
)的网卡,我的是wlan0,每个人
Li_Lin
·
2021-04-02 13:57
锁机制初探(五)
Moniter
的实现原理
在深入理解多线程(一)——Synchronized的实现原理中介绍过关于Synchronize的实现原理,无论是同步方法还是同步代码块,无论是ACC_SYNCHRONIZED还是monitorenter、monitorexit都是基于Monitor实现的,那么这篇来介绍下什么是Monitor。操作系统中的管程如果你在大学学习过操作系统,你可能还记得管程(monitors)在操作系统中是很重要的概念
匍匐-菜鸟
·
2020-09-14 19:09
java多线程设计模式
mysql双机热备+heartbeat集群+自动故障转移
192.168.10.197,一台为192.168.10.198,对外提供服务的vip为192.168.10.200备注:heartbeat本身是不能做到服务不可用自动切换的,所以用结合额外的脚本才可以做到,本文中提到的
moniter
weixin_34292402
·
2020-09-11 22:55
ubuntu-12.04下安装postgresql
2013-10-0120:42:57|
moniter
参考资料:Ubuntu12.04下PostgreSQL-9.1安装与配置详解(在线安装)一.安装postgresqlbamboo@bamboo-Inspiron
weixin_30279751
·
2020-08-18 03:51
管程(
Moniter
) 并发编程的基本心法
在吃透Syncchronized原理中介绍了关于Synchronize的实现原理,无论是同步方法还是同步代码块,无论是ACC_SYNCHRONIZED还是monitorenter、monitorexit都是基于Monitor实现的,那么这篇来介绍下什么是Monitor。所谓管程:指的是管理共享变量以及对共享变量的操作过程,让它们支持并发。翻译为Java就是管理类的成员变量和成员方法,让这个类是线程
圈T社区
·
2020-08-11 06:50
圈T社区
【深入理解多线程】
Moniter
的实现原理(四)
在深入理解多线程(一)——Synchronized的实现原理中介绍过关于Synchronize的实现原理,无论是同步方法还是同步代码块,无论是ACC_SYNCHRONIZED还是monitorenter、monitorexit都是基于Monitor实现的,那么这篇来介绍下什么是Monitor。操作系统中的管程如果你在大学学习过操作系统,你可能还记得管程(monitors)在操作系统中是很重要的概念
Franco蜡笔小强
·
2020-08-10 02:11
多线程
linux disk io
moniter
shell
转http://wangchengtai.blog.hexun.com/39388948_d.htmlUnix/Linux磁盘I/O性能监控命令磁盘I/O性能监控指标和调优方法在介绍磁盘I/O监控命令前,我们需要了解磁盘I/O性能监控的指标,以及每个指标的所揭示的磁盘某方面的性能。磁盘I/O性能监控的指标主要包括:指标1:每秒I/O数(IOPS或tps)对于磁盘来说,一次磁盘的连续读或者连续写称为
lingzhi007
·
2020-07-28 02:02
linux
app
深入理解多线程(四)—
Moniter
的实现原理
深入理解多线程(四)—
Moniter
的实现原理在深入理解多线程(一)—Synchronized的实现原理中介绍过关于Synchronize的实现原理,无论是同步方法还是同步代码块,无论是ACC_SYNCHRONIZED
小潭渔
·
2020-07-13 16:27
高并发与多线程
aircrack-ng+crunch暴力破解WIFI密码
不要对其中的命令死记硬背,先要把原理和步骤搞清楚开始:1.打开WIFI,但是要断开wifi连接,防止后面出现错误2.airmon-ng查看支持监控(
moniter
)的网卡,我
颜科鸣_5482
·
2020-07-07 22:17
bluetooth BLE enable , WIFI
Moniter
mode
enablebluetoothblemode:frameworks/base/core/res/res/values/config.xml-false+true2.setwifimoniter:ThisdocumentintroducehowtotriggermonitormodetosnifferpacketsintheairbyRealtekWiFisulotion.1.Pleasemakes
SamJiangJS
·
2020-07-06 20:53
开发
监控服务器cpu,mem,disk自动邮件报警,并将数据写入表中。
加入crontab中,5分钟执行一次*/5****/home/ymx/
moniter
.sh>>/home/ymx/
moniter
.log2>&1脚本如下#!
金桔乐园
·
2020-07-01 07:24
shell
【转】Linux shell IO重定向
分别指向的是:Keyboard设备文件,
Moniter
设备文件,和
Moniter
设备文件。Shell中还允许有3--9的FD,默认都没有打开,可以认为指向的为NULL。
GoRustNeverStop
·
2020-06-29 17:10
linux/unix
shell
Zabbix批量添加web监控模板
web监控模板(zbx_web_monitor_templates.xml)1、agent端批量添加脚本/data/zabbix/scripts/web_site_
moniter
.py#!/usr
weixin_33883178
·
2020-06-28 07:59
Zabbix批量添加web监控模板
web监控模板(zbx_web_monitor_templates.xml)1、agent端批量添加脚本/data/zabbix/scripts/web_site_
moniter
.py#!/usr
蜷缩的蜗牛
·
2020-06-24 23:57
并发编程面试题
常见的三种用法:普通方法,静态方法同步代码块普通方法和静态方法实现锁是通过ACC_SYNCHRONIZED标志,同步代码块通过MonitorEnter和
Moniter
diaozuo6485
·
2020-06-23 04:14
Java并发那些事儿-
Moniter
在多线程访问共享资源的时候,经常会带来可见性和原子性的安全问题。为了解决这类线程安全的问题,Java提供了同步机制、互斥锁机制,这些机制保证了在同一时刻只有一个线程能访问共享资源。这些机制的保障来源于监视锁Monitor,每个对象都拥有自己的监视锁Monitor。Monitor是一种同步工具,也说是一种同步机制,它通常被描述为一个对象,主要特点是:对象(Monitor)的所有方法都被“互斥”的执行
绍圣
·
2020-02-08 17:40
20170928
时间管理原定计划monitor最终版讨论国电,包商问题战略作业ppt今天很累,从上午的毫无思路,到发现
moniter
.jsp的low错误,再到找到产品问题的开心,再到打车到包商发现没问题。
十年搬了30次家
·
2020-02-06 21:25
锁的问答
高版本后的锁膨胀机制,大大提高性能,再说底层实现,Lock的乐观锁机制,通过AQS队列同步器,调用了unsafe的CAS操作,CAS函数的参数及意义;同时可以说说synchronized底层原理,jvm层的
moniter
HikariCP
·
2020-01-08 03:38
管程(
Moniter
): 并发编程的基本心法
JavaStorm关注公众号获取更多并发在吃透Syncchronized原理中介绍了关于Synchronize的实现原理,无论是同步方法还是同步代码块,无论是ACC_SYNCHRONIZED还是monitorenter、monitorexit都是基于Monitor实现的,那么这篇来介绍下什么是Monitor。所谓管程:指的是管理共享变量以及对共享变量的操作过程,让它们支持并发。翻译为Java就是管
公众号JavaStorm
·
2019-12-20 11:00
一个切图工具分享(python)
最近开发的android应用上架小米的时候总是报outofmemory错误,仔细review了N多遍代码,并没有发现那里不妥的地方,而且自己使用过程中也没有崩溃过.于是使用
moniter
监测了一下内存,
votzone
·
2019-11-01 23:10
查看Python安装路径以及安装包路径小技巧
复制代码代码如下:G:\code\
moniter
>python-c"fromdistutils.sysconfigimportget_python_lib;print(get_python_lib(
·
2019-09-23 21:38
深入理解多线程-
Moniter
的实现原理
阅读更多操作系统中的管程如果你在大学学习过操作系统,你可能还记得管程(monitors)在操作系统中是很重要的概念。同样Monitor在java同步机制中也有使用。管程(英语:Monitors,也称为监视器)是一种程序结构,结构内的多个子程序(对象或模块)形成的多个工作线程互斥访问共享资源。这些共享资源一般是硬件设备或一群变量。管程实现了在一个时间点,最多只有一个线程在执行管程的某个子程序。与那些
yuqingshui
·
2019-07-29 16:00
java
并发
多线程
深入理解多线程-
Moniter
的实现原理
阅读更多操作系统中的管程如果你在大学学习过操作系统,你可能还记得管程(monitors)在操作系统中是很重要的概念。同样Monitor在java同步机制中也有使用。管程(英语:Monitors,也称为监视器)是一种程序结构,结构内的多个子程序(对象或模块)形成的多个工作线程互斥访问共享资源。这些共享资源一般是硬件设备或一群变量。管程实现了在一个时间点,最多只有一个线程在执行管程的某个子程序。与那些
yuqingshui
·
2019-07-29 16:00
java
并发
多线程
微擎增删改查
c=wiki&do=view&id=1&list=173符合微擎命名规则的数据表ims_模块名_表名//如ims_health_
moniter
_orders增加int|booleanpdo_insert
StevenQin
·
2019-04-25 00:55
lab7(管程)
管程
moniter
结构mutex:初始值为1,用于对管程的互斥访问next:初始值为0,作为一个等待队列,用于阻塞已获得mutex的进程,next_count用于记录阻塞于next的进程数,类似于条件变量中的等待队列
smmrSangria
·
2019-03-30 13:00
ucore
线程同步-同步代码区
Moniter
类用于同步代码区,其思想是首先使用Monitor.Enter()方法获得一个锁,然后使用
Moniter
.Exit()方法释放该锁。
辣条不爱辣
·
2018-12-01 15:48
操作系统
Java之锁的实现原理
文章目录synchronized实现原理同步代码块的底层实现同步方法的底层实现
moniter
机制可重入锁的解释提供的Lock锁synchronized的优化CAS操作什么是CAS?
HL_HLHL
·
2018-11-29 11:36
java语法
【Java并发】——并发关键字(一)
目录一、synchronized1.如何使用方法一:实例方法(锁的是实例对象)方法二:静态方法(锁的是类对象)方法三:同步代码块(代码块根据配置,锁的是实例对象也可以是类对象)2.
moniter
机制3.
CodeLikeWind
·
2018-08-07 10:05
java学习记录
Java并发
雨后初晴 P3ESR 与 M20.1 的真正区别
但问题是,当时
Moniter
20型
雨后初晴小组
·
2018-07-17 10:24
查看已安装tensorflow版本和路径,查看Python路径
__path__查询结果如下:3、查询自己安装的python路径代码如下:G:\code\
moniter
>python-c"fromdistutils.s
爱草莓的番茄酱
·
2018-05-04 16:23
干货
bluetooth BLE enable , WIFI
Moniter
mode
enablebluetoothblemode:frameworks/base/core/res/res/values/config.xml-false+true2.setwifimoniter:ThisdocumentintroducehowtotriggermonitormodetosnifferpacketsintheairbyRealtekWiFisulotion.1.Pleasemakes
SamJiangJS
·
2018-01-02 11:11
开发
一个demo学会c#
此demo主要包括五个文件:Students.cs和
Moniter
.cs文件,包含了自定义空间、空间函数、空间变量、空间自定义类;Interface1.cs文件和Interface2.cs文件为接
数据架构师
·
2017-08-02 09:53
c#
c#开发手册
Zabbix批量添加web监控模板
web监控模板(zbx_web_monitor_templates.xml)1、agent端批量添加脚本/data/zabbix/scripts/web_site_
moniter
.py#!/usr
蜷缩的蜗牛
·
2016-12-29 15:57
python
zabbix
监控主机
监控平台
SQL Tuning Advisor 使用11G的自动调优建议
先给监控用户授权grantadvisortoDBA_
MONITER
;可以在PL/SQLDEVELOPER命令窗口执行SQL_ID方式DECLAREmy_task_nameVARCHAR2(30);BEGINmy_task_name
客家族_祖仙教_小凡仙
·
2016-06-03 11:30
Oracle
管理
SQL Tuning Advisor 使用11G的自动调优建议
先给监控用户授权 grantadvisorto DBA_
MONITER
;可以在PL/SQLDEVELOPER命令窗口执行 SQL_ID方式DECLARE my_task_nameVARCHAR2(30)
ZengMuAnSha
·
2016-06-03 11:00
Task Self
moniter
publicclassProgram { readonlystaticobjectlockobj=newobject(); staticvoidMain(string[]args) { log4net.Config.XmlConfigurator.Configure(); intc=0; varmakeIds=newList(); usi
lglgsy456
·
2016-04-29 13:00
shell vs python脚本监控http请求
/bin/bash# This shell is used to
moniter
192.168.
Jx战壕
·
2016-01-24 03:13
重启
shell
http
Shell/Python/Go
shell vs python脚本监控http请求
/bin/bash # This shell is used to
moniter
192
Jx战壕
·
2016-01-24 03:13
http
shell
重启
常识
Hub:集线器 Mouse:鼠标 Case:机箱 Pin:针脚 Power:电源
Moniter
:屏幕 Scanner:扫描仪 S
·
2015-11-12 21:09
记一次apache+php调优
2015-3-11 调试 首先去服务器进程看了看,发现有一个 http.exe 在后台一直占用%50左右的 cpu,即使通过
Moniter
结束
·
2015-11-12 16:42
apache
apache启动命令和端口介绍
(1、我们可以通过该服务来 启动和关闭apache, (2、也可以通过 apache
moniter
·
2015-11-12 12:16
apache
Android Studio使用技巧小记
1.Android Studio中查看genymotion模拟器中的文件的方法: Tools-->Android Device
Moniter
2.快速定位开源代码某功能的实现方法
·
2015-11-11 17:48
android
Studio
上一页
1
2
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他